| Nutrient | Fish, salmon, red, canned, bones removed (Alaska Native) | Egg, whole, raw, fresh |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Calories | 161 kcal | 143 kcal ★ | Fish, salmon, red, canned, bones removed (Alaska Native) has 13% more |
| Protein | 27.31 g ★ | 12.56 g | Fish, salmon, red, canned, bones removed (Alaska Native) has 117% more |
| Carbs | 0 g | 0.72 g ★ | Egg, whole, raw, fresh has 100% more |
| Fat | 5.76 g ★ | 9.51 g | Egg, whole, raw, fresh has 39% more |
| Sugar | 0 g ★ | 0.37 g | Egg, whole, raw, fresh has 100% more |
| Sodium | 390 mg | 142 mg ★ | Fish, salmon, red, canned, bones removed (Alaska Native) has 175% more |
| Calcium | 28 mg | 56 mg ★ | Egg, whole, raw, fresh has 50% more |
| Iron | 1.9 mg ★ | 1.75 mg | Fish, salmon, red, canned, bones removed (Alaska Native) has 9% more |
| Potassium | 370 mg ★ | 138 mg | Fish, salmon, red, canned, bones removed (Alaska Native) has 168% more |
